Langham Square is a St James development located in Putney, adjacent to East Putney underground station. The development is a collection of 1, 2 and 3-bedroom apartments and penthouses all with private outdoor space. Residents of this 104 apartment development also benefit from ground floor retail shops, cafes, a public piazza, and basement car and cycle parking.

The building itself has a good design, but after living here for almost 7 years now it's possible to notice that it wasn't well built and maybe materials used weren't of the greatest quality. We had problems early on with heating, that until these days suddenly breaks leaving everyone in the building without hot water or heating. Electrical problems all over the flat with faulty sockets and light bulb sockets. Radiators that leak all or stop working even despite regular maintenance. And lastly, the increasing price of service charge that has now nearly doubled and the building has no facilities like a sitting area outside, or gym space like the other new buildings around.

Stamford square (Ireton house): It's been now 5 years since completion. We had an issue with the quality of the wall painting and wooden floors that were stained with white drops of paint. A crew was sent to fix this but they scratched and stained the walls. All works in the building were done at a very mediocre quality since then there were several complaints from neighbours with leakages and serious wall infiltration to the point that some walls got as soft as a marshmallow. They kept knocking on our door to check if the infiltration was originated in our apartment. this happened 3 times so far. It was very annoying but we're relieved these leakages hadnt affected our flat. Another problem is the building identification. We've had several problems with lost/delayed correspondence and parcels because delivery services couldnt find the property. There are no clear signs identifying the development and the 2 residence buildings that are part of it: Ireton house (3 Stamford square) and Rainsborough house (5 Stamford square).

Langham Square is a development by the Berkley group and quality of building is to a high standard. The one bedrooms are practically designed with excellent Siemens fittings in the kitchen and villeroy boch fittings in the bathroom. Entrance has double security both at the main door and elevator. There is parking available in the basement but owners are not eligible for street parking.
